I think this is just the style chosen by the replying client to add the reply/citation "header". Gnus apparently does that too here. SeaMonkey might be able to if the preference is set in user.js [1]. It likely isn't caused by anything on your side, and just by how clients quoting your message choose to lay out that "header", with or without a blank line below it.
